Ureaplasma occupies contested ground: it's a bacterium commonly found in the genital tracts of healthy, sexually inactive people, yet certain strains associate with urethritis, bacterial vaginosis-like states, adverse pregnancy outcomes, and infertility research. Because sexual contact increases colonization rates, many clinicians treat symptomatic ureaplasma like an STI — testing and treating partners — even though official guidelines remain deliberately cautious about when it truly matters.

Commensal or Pathogen? The Evidence Tug-of-War
Detection frequencies complicate everything: ureaplasma appears in sizable fractions of asymptomatic reproductive-age populations, meaning finding it proves little by itself. Yet case-control data repeatedly find higher loads in men with nongonococcal urethritis minus chlamydia, and observational links thread through PID, chorioamnionitis, and preterm labor literature. Causality falters partly because QUANTITATIVE burden (not mere presence) likely separates passenger from perpetrator — a nuance older qualitative PCRs ignored entirely.
How It Relates to Sexual Health
Colonization correlates with sexual activity onset and partner count, and vertical acquisition happens at birth before gradually clearing. Symptomatic couples frequently transmit strains bidirectionally — hence the 'ping-pong' pattern patients describe. Practically, clinicians managing persistent urethritis or unexplained discharge run the standard battery FIRST (chlamydia/gonorrhea NAATs, trich, mycoplasma genitalium) and consider ureaplasma only within that differential, since chasing it reflexively leads to overtreatment of harmless carriage. Current Guideline Positions
- CDC STI Treatment Guidelines: ureaplasma NOT recommended as routine test-or-treat target for urethritis
- European (IUSTI) guidance: similarly cautious; role considered uncertain/minor
- Reproductive medicine: some fertility clinics still screen/treat empirically — practice varies widely
- Sensible default: treat SYMPTOMATIC individuals after excluding established pathogens; skip asymptomatic 'clearance' attempts
If You Test Positive — Decision Framework
Three questions decide action. First: symptoms? Discharge, dysuria, pelvic pain justify treatment consideration; incidental detection during fertility workups usually warrants watchfulness. Second: alternatives excluded? Chlamydia, gonorrhea, Mgen, trich each demand priority because their management is standardized. Third: partner context? Symptomatic partner pairs favor simultaneous treatment regardless of classification debates. Regimens typically involve doxycycline followed by azithromycin for refractory cases — never self-medicate with leftover antibiotics (see why amoxicillin fails here too). Retest-positives after appropriate therapy usually represent recolonization, not failure.
Frequently Asked Questions
My partner tested positive for ureaplasma — did they cheat?
Impossible to conclude. Carriage is common in low-risk people and can persist from long-past relationships. Treat symptoms, not suspicions.
Should I demand ureaplasma testing with my annual STI screen?
Guidelines advise against routine inclusion. If you have persistent symptoms despite negative standard tests, targeted PCR makes sense then.
Is ureaplasma linked to miscarriage?
Studies show associations with some adverse pregnancy outcomes, but causation remains unsettled and routine screening in pregnancy isn't recommended. Discuss individually with your OB.
What antibiotic clears ureaplasma?
Doxycycline is first-line when treatment IS indicated; azithromycin covers macrolide-sensitive strains. Resistance patterns vary — clinician-directed therapy beats guesswork.
